| Description | N-(3-Oxoundecanoyl)-L-homoserine lactone is a small diffusible signaling molecule and is a member of N-acyl-homoserine lactone family. N-acylhomoserine lactones (AHL) are involved in quorum sensing, controlling gene expression, and cellular metabolism. The diverse applications of this kind of molecule include regulation of virulence in general, infection prevention, and formation of biofilms. Numerous species of bacteria employ 3OC11-HSL in cell-to-cell communication. Shown to have immune suppressive activity, inhibiting murine and human leucocyte proliferation. |
